Your Embrace

Rating: 5.0


Ten pages on my phone bill
Nine nails in my front door
Eight cracks in the ceiling
Seven times I regret
seeing you no more
Six broken bottles
Five moths on my windows
Four times the wind bangs
the fly screen
Three rose petals
Two cappuccinos
One memory of your embrace
No time to remember
